Step 2: Deep Hydration and Regeneration

Dry epidermis is a permanent makeup artist's number one enemy. On dehydrated skin, the pigment can exfoliate unevenly during the healing phase, leading to patchy results or an overly faint final look. The skin must be supple, elastic, and thoroughly saturated with moisture from within.

Step 3: Cleansing and Smoothing Skin Texture

Another significant challenge is skin that is blocked by blackheads or struggling with excessive sebum production. Excess oil can literally "push out" the pigment during the healing process, causing the healed lines to look blurred and less precise.

Approximately 2 to 3 weeks before your scheduled permanent makeup appointment, it is highly recommended to opt for a professional skin refresh and unblock the sebaceous glands. Relaxation for Facial Muscles: Forget About Stress

Did you know that intense muscle tension in the forehead and eyebrow area can significantly hinder a precise preliminary sketch? When we are stressed, our mimetic muscles work asymmetrically.
